Домашняя страница Undo Do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Перемещение фигур к конкретным словам -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, китин  
Перемещение фигур к конкретным словам
Бонифаций Дата: Воскресенье, 16.12.2018, 06:53 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 8
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Приветствую всех.

В документе word находятся фигуры Rectangle 4, AutoShape 8
Также там - в некоторых местах вписаны слова СЛОВО-1,СЛОВО-N.

Как макросом выполнить перемещение фигур к этим словам ?
Прямоугольник - к "СЛОВО-1", Треугольник - к "СЛОВО-N".

Сейчас фигуры могут двигаться - только смещаясь на небольшие расстояния.
[vba]
Код

Sub Макрос4()
    ActiveDocument.Shapes("AutoShape 8").Select
    Selection.ShapeRange.IncrementLeft 117#
    Selection.ShapeRange.IncrementTop 81#

    ActiveDocument.Shapes("Rectangle 4").Select
    Selection.ShapeRange.IncrementLeft -26.85
    Selection.ShapeRange.IncrementTop 63.15
End Sub
[/vba]
К сообщению приложен файл: 8382008.doc (38.5 Kb)
 
Ответить
СообщениеПриветствую всех.

В документе word находятся фигуры Rectangle 4, AutoShape 8
Также там - в некоторых местах вписаны слова СЛОВО-1,СЛОВО-N.

Как макросом выполнить перемещение фигур к этим словам ?
Прямоугольник - к "СЛОВО-1", Треугольник - к "СЛОВО-N".

Сейчас фигуры могут двигаться - только смещаясь на небольшие расстояния.
[vba]
Код

Sub Макрос4()
    ActiveDocument.Shapes("AutoShape 8").Select
    Selection.ShapeRange.IncrementLeft 117#
    Selection.ShapeRange.IncrementTop 81#

    ActiveDocument.Shapes("Rectangle 4").Select
    Selection.ShapeRange.IncrementLeft -26.85
    Selection.ShapeRange.IncrementTop 63.15
End Sub
[/vba]

Автор - Бонифаций
Дата добавления - 16.12.2018 в 06:53
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!